Understanding Collision Repair Safety Standards

vehicle

Collision repair safety standards serve as the cornerstone for ensuring the well-being of both workers and customers within collision centers and auto repair shops. Understanding these standards is paramount for any business involved in vehicle restoration, as they dictate the procedures and protocols necessary to mitigate risks associated with the complex processes involved. These regulations encompass a wide range of aspects, from proper handling of hazardous materials to safe operation of heavy machinery and adherence to strict fire safety measures.

For instance, many collision repair safety standards align with widely recognized industry guidelines, such as those set forth by organizations like the National Fire Protection Association (NFPA). These guidelines provide detailed instructions on managing combustible materials, electrical hazards, and potential exposure to toxic substances commonly found in auto body work. Auto repair shops and collision centers must train their staff extensively on these protocols to prevent accidents and ensure compliance. Furthermore, regular inspections and maintenance of safety equipment, such as fire extinguishers and personal protective gear (PPG), are non-negotiable to maintain a safe working environment.

Practical implementation involves creating comprehensive safety programs tailored to each shop’s unique operations. This includes developing clear policies for material storage, workplace organization, and emergency response procedures. For example, in collision centers handling hazardous liquids like paint thinners or solvents, proper containment systems and ventilation must be in place to prevent leaks or vapor exposure. Regular training sessions, mock drills, and ongoing communication among employees are essential to instill a strong safety culture within the shop floor. By adhering to these standards, collision repair facilities not only protect their workforce but also contribute to the overall quality and integrity of vehicle restoration services.

Implementing Best Practices for Compliance

vehicle

In ensuring the safety and quality of car collision repair services, adhering to established collision repair safety standards is non-negotiable. These standards, developed by industry experts and regulatory bodies, provide a framework for best practices in vehicle body shops and car scratch repair facilities. For instance, the National Institute for Occupational Safety and Health (NIOSH) offers guidelines focusing on workplace safety, including proper handling of hazardous materials and ergonomic considerations to prevent injuries among auto body repair technicians.

Implementing these collision repair safety standards requires a multi-faceted approach. First, management commitment is vital; leaders must prioritize compliance as a core value, regularly reviewing and updating safety protocols to keep up with industry advancements. For example, car collision repair shops should stay abreast of the latest technologies in materials science, ensuring that repairs not only meet aesthetic standards but also preserve vehicle structural integrity. Next, comprehensive employee training is essential. Technicians should be educated on proper use of tools and equipment, as well as safety measures specific to their tasks. A practical insight from industry experts suggests conducting regular refresher courses to mitigate the risks associated with repetitive tasks common in car scratch repair processes.

Furthermore, maintaining a safe workspace involves continuous assessment and improvement. Regular inspections should be conducted to identify potential hazards and ensure adherence to safety standards. This proactive approach not only reduces the risk of accidents but also fosters an environment where quality and safety are deeply ingrained in every stage of vehicle body shop operations.
